Reading this book, with the help of the Bible and advice based on Christian values, you will discover the power of hope on every page!

Most people know that regular physical activity and a balanced diet are habits that lead to satisfaction and good health, but what to do when the disease is not present in a certain part of the body?

Are you… ... felt broken due to numerous obligations? ... been so overwhelmed that you couldn't cross everything off your to-do list? … felt guilty while fighting addiction? ... wanted to give up everything and run away to a deserted island?

If your answers are yes, know that you are not the only one and you are not alone!

At this moment, millions of people suffer from the effects of anxiety, stress and depression - problems that are becoming more and more common in our anxious, demanding and disoriented world. If you are facing the above or if someone you know is facing similar challenges, know that the book The Power of Hope is the first step on the way to a solution!

The book The Power of Hope will show you how you can restore meaning to your life. They will teach you how to live a successful life and will reveal the answers that will help you get on the path to peace, a calmer life, renewal and healing.
